The Seahawks’ 2020 regular season and preseason schedules have been released, with the team opening the season on the road and scheduled for four primetime games, three of which will be at home.

Here’s the full schedule (all games Sunday unless otherwise noted):
• Week 1, Sept. 13: Seattle at Atlanta Falcons
• Week 2, Sept. 20: Seattle vs New England Patriots – Sunday Night Football
• Week 3, Sept. 27: Seattle vs Dallas Cowboys
• Week 4, Oct. 4: Seattle at Miami Dolphins
• Week 5, Oct. 11: Seattle vs Minnesota Vikings – Sunday Night Football
• Week 6: BYE WEEK
• Week 7, Oct. 25: Seattle at Arizona Cardinals
• Week 8, Nov. 1: Seattle vs San Francisco 49ers
• Week 9, Nov. 8: Seattle at Buffalo Bills
• Week 10, Nov. 15: Seattle at Los Angeles Rams
• Week 11, Nov. 19: Seattle vs Arizona Cardinals – Thursday Night Football
• Week 12, Nov. 30: Seattle at Philadelphia Eagles – Monday Night Football
• Week 13, Dec. 6: Seattle vs New York Giants
• Week 14, Dec. 13: Seattle vs New York Jets
• Week 15, Dec. 20: Seattle at Washington Redskins
• Week 16, Dec. 27: Seattle vs Los Angeles Rams
• Week 17, Jan. 3: Seattle at San Francisco 49ers

Notes
• For the second year in a row, Seattle closes the regular season with the San Francisco 49ers. This year, however, the season finale takes place on the road.
• Seattle will once again host the Minnesota Vikings in one of their primetime games. Last year, Seattle won a 37-30 game on Monday Night Football at home in Week 13. In 2020, the Vikings again return to CenturyLink Field, but it will take place on Sunday Night Football in Week 5.
• Seattle will also be one of the first teams to face the Tom Brady-less New England Patriots. The longtime New England quarterback signed with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ers in free agency. Bill Belichick and company will come to Seattle for Sunday Night Football in Week 2.
• After a relatively late bye week in 2019, the Seahawks will have a much earlier one. Last season, Seattle’s off week was Week 11. In 2020, the team will have Week 6 off after playing the Vikings in primetime. When they return to action, they will travel to Arizona to take on the Cardinals in Seattle’s first divisional game of the year.
Seahawks preseason schedule
• Preseason 1 (Aug. 13-17): Seattle vs Las Vegas Raiders
• Preseason 2 (Aug. 20-24): Seattle at Houston Texans
• Preseason 3 (Aug. 27-30): Seattle vs Los Angeles Chargers
• Preseason 4 (Sept. 3-4): Seattle at Minnestota Vikings
